Output 31e14a574ee5951d26557e47f29fa8b886db80b57e50b918b36c88ff1179f121:3

value
617694
script pubkey
OP_0 OP_PUSHBYTES_20 29528731154c11cc9205e921f7949fbdd725e305
address
bc1q99fgwvg4fsgueys9aysl09ylhhtjtcc92mu3r5
transaction
31e14a574ee5951d26557e47f29fa8b886db80b57e50b918b36c88ff1179f121
spent
true